Major Products and Technologies
Steam Tube Dryer (STD)
The Steam Tube Dryer (STD) is the main type of large-sized dryer in which we specialize. This dryer is adopted in a wide industrial range, including the petrochemistry, iron and steel industry, and food industry. Tsukishima Kikai boasts of approximately 70% of the global market share, particularly in the field of production plants for purified terephthalic acid, which is a raw material of polyester fiber. The most advantageous features of the STD are its large drying capacity, wide range of applications, simple construction for ease of operation, low volume of exhaust gas, due to indirect heating. Tsukishima Kikai has ample experience of over 400 units sold in the world.

BPA Production Plant
Polycarbonate (PC) is used widely in the production of compact discs and automotive parts, and epoxy resin is used in coating, laminates, and adhesives. Demand for both PC and epoxy resin has grown steadily along with the development of industry. Tsukishima Kikai's technologies used in crystallization, dispersion and distillation carry an important role on manufacturing facilities that produce bisphenol A, a raw material used to create PC and epoxy resin. Tsukishima Kikai contributes to industrial development with its core technologies which are centered on the double propeller (DP) type crystallization having unique agitation blades.

Terminology
PTA: Purified Terephthalic Acid
A raw material used to create polyester, PTA is also used in PET (polyethylene terephthalate) bottles. Recently, the restricted supply of paraxylene (PX) has weakened the production of purified terephthalic acid. However, investments in PTA manufacturing facilities are currently being done, based on anticipation of greater demand after three years from now (2010 or later), and the mid-term demand for purified terephthalic acid is expected to continue growing primarily in China and India. (PTA is estimated to grow at a rate of 8 to 9% in 2007 through 2010.)
BPA: Bisphenol A
Approximately 70% of Bisphenol A (BPA) is used as a raw material in polycarbonate. BPA has shown high growth in correlation with an increase in demand for polycarbonate (PC) in recent years. PC is applied to the production of a wide range of everyday commodities, such as home appliances and office automation equipment. Now that its application is extending to the optical and automotive industries, the demand BPA is showing a high growth rate. The growth rate of the global demand for BPA in 2006 and 2007 was 7% worldwide and 8% in Asia. (Middle-to-long-term projections estimate a 6% growth worldwide due to market expansions in China and BRICs, and 12% in Asia)
